The 2006 Open Gaz de France was a women's tennis tournament played on indoor hard courts. It was the 14th edition of the Open Gaz de France and was part of Tier II of the 2006 WTA Tour. The tournament took place at the Stade Pierre de Coubertin in Paris in France from February 6 through February 12, 2006. Amélie Mauresmo won the singles title.
